English: Newton House in the parish of Newton St Cyres, Devon, 1797 watercolour by Rev. John Swete (d.1821). View entitled: Newton House, seat of J. Quicke, Esq.. No date given, but Swete visited Newton St Cyres as part of his 1797 Picturesque Tour, during which he painted other houses, all dated 1797. Devon Record Office DRO 564M/F11/153
